Material Prices



When it concerns roofing system setup, material expenses play a substantial duty in identifying the overall expenditure. The type of roof product you pick will significantly influence both the first financial investment and lasting upkeep expenses.

As an example, asphalt roof shingles are a popular and economical selection, while metal roofing often tends to be a lot more resilient however comes with a greater price tag. It's vital to take into consideration aspects such as long life, energy efficiency, and aesthetic appeal when picking roof products.

In addition, the dimension and incline of your roofing system will certainly affect the quantity of products needed. Steeper roofing systems call for even more products and labor due to the intricacy of installment. Make certain to precisely measure your roof covering's dimensions to stay clear of over or ignoring material needs, which can result in added expenditures in the future.

Prior to choosing, research different product options, contrast rates, and consider speaking with an expert contractor to determine the most effective selection for your home. Keep in mind, purchasing quality materials upfront can save you money in the future by minimizing the need for constant fixings or substitutes.

Unveiling Hidden Charges



Uncovering hidden costs is vital when planning for a roofing system setup job. These stealthy added prices can considerably impact your budget if not made up upfront.

One usual surprise charge to look out for is the price of permits. Depending upon your location, allows might be needed for the installation of a brand-new roofing system, and the fees can differ. It's important to factor these costs into your general spending plan to stay clear of any type of surprises.


An additional concealed cost that commonly captures homeowners off-guard is the need for roofing fixings discovered throughout the installation procedure. If the roofing contractor finds underlying concerns such as water damages or structural issues, the needed repairs can include unanticipated prices to your job. To stop these surprises, think about getting a comprehensive examination before starting the installment.
